Problem
When you install IBM Operational Decision Manager 9.0.0 on Microsoft Windows Server 2022, you cannot create ruleflows and decision tables in their default editors in Rule Designer.
Symptom
After installing Operational Decision Manager 9.0.0 on Windows Server 2022, you encounter problems with the following editors in Rule Designer:
- Default ruleflow editor: You cannot create ruleflows.
- Default decision table editor: You cannot create decision tables.
